🔧 Product Overview

The Synergy Microsystems VGM5-F is a high-performance VMEbus Single Board Computer designed for embedded and real-time computing applications. The VGM5 series uses IBM/Motorola PowerPC processor architecture and is designed for industrial, scientific, defense, and specialized equipment systems requiring VMEbus integration.

The RGS3-B designation is associated with the board assembly supplied with this unit. The exact configuration of an individual VGM5-F board can vary depending on the installed processor, DRAM, Flash memory, and optional hardware. Therefore, the physical board configuration should always be checked before using it as a replacement.

🖥️ Processor Architecture

The VGM5 platform is built around PowerPC processor technology and can support either a single processor or a dual processor configuration.

Depending on the board version, the system may use:

  • IBM PowerPC 750 / G3 processors
  • PowerPC 7400 / G4 processors
  • Single CPU configuration
  • Dual CPU configuration
  • High-speed shared SDRAM architecture

Different VGM5-F boards have been documented with configurations including 128 MB, 256 MB, and 512 MB DRAM, as well as different PowerPC processor versions. The exact CPU and memory configuration of the RGS3-B assembly should therefore be verified from the physical board.

🔌 VMEbus Integration

The VGM5 is designed for installation in a compatible VMEbus chassis.

The board architecture supports features associated with real-time VME applications, including:

  • Direct CPU-to-VMEbus communication
  • Low-latency VMEbus access
  • VME64x support
  • VME Read-Modify-Write cycle support
  • Hot insertion and extraction support
  • P2 I/O capability depending on configuration

Before installation, the VMEbus chassis, slot configuration, backplane, and system firmware requirements should be checked carefully.

 

🛠️ Installation Guidelines

Before replacing a VGM5-F board:

  1. Shut down the host equipment completely.
  2. Disconnect the system power according to the equipment procedure.
  3. Follow ESD protection requirements.
  4. Record the existing board configuration.
  5. Check the complete VGM5-F identification.
  6. Confirm the RGS3-B assembly marking.
  7. Compare CPU configuration.
  8. Compare installed memory.
  9. Check Flash and NVRAM configuration.
  10. Inspect VMEbus connectors.
  11. Confirm PMC modules, if installed.
  12. Restore the original board settings where required.

The replacement board should not be assumed compatible solely because it is labeled VGM5-F. CPU configuration, memory, firmware, and host-system software can affect compatibility.
